In the world of manufacturing and industrial processes, conveyor belts play a crucial role in the smooth and efficient transportation of materials. These belts are used in a wide range of industries including food processing, packaging, automotive, and more. While traditional conveyor belts were typically made of materials like rubber or metal, plastic belting has become increasingly popular due to its many benefits and advantages.
plastic belting, also known as modular belting, is made from plastic materials such as polyethylene, polypropylene, or acetal. These materials are lightweight, durable, and resistant to chemicals and corrosion, making them ideal for a variety of industrial applications. plastic belting is typically constructed in interlocking modules that form a continuous belt, allowing for easy installation, maintenance, and repairs.
One of the key advantages of plastic belting is its versatility. Unlike traditional conveyor belts that come in fixed sizes and shapes, plastic belting can be easily customized to fit specific requirements. This means that companies can easily tailor their conveyor systems to suit their unique needs, whether it’s transporting delicate products in the food industry or heavy-duty materials in manufacturing plants.
plastic belting is also easy to clean and maintain, making it ideal for industries that require strict hygiene standards such as food processing and pharmaceuticals. The smooth surface of plastic belting prevents the build-up of dirt, debris, and bacteria, reducing the risk of contamination and ensuring product safety. Additionally, plastic belting is resistant to moisture and can withstand high temperatures, making it suitable for washdown applications and harsh environments.
Another major advantage of plastic belting is its durability and longevity. Plastic materials are highly resistant to wear and tear, resulting in longer service life and reduced maintenance costs. Unlike traditional conveyor belts that may require frequent repairs or replacements, plastic belting is designed to withstand heavy loads and continuous use without degrading or breaking down.
Furthermore, plastic belting offers enhanced flexibility and efficiency in conveyor systems. The modular design of plastic belting allows for easy installation and reconfiguration, making it simple to adapt to changing production needs or layouts. This flexibility enables companies to improve productivity, reduce downtime, and optimize their operations for maximum efficiency.
In addition to these practical benefits, plastic belting is also environmentally friendly. Plastic materials are recyclable and can be reused to create new products, reducing waste and minimizing the impact on the environment.
